PRINCESS ANNE, Md. (Aug. 30, 2025)--The Morgan State Lady Bears opened their 2025 cross country season on Saturday at the University of Maryland Eastern Shore Season Opener, taking on a competitive field that included Norfolk State, Delaware State, and host UMES.
The Lady Bears showed promise in their first outing of the year, highlighted by two standout performances in the top 10.
Aaliyah Headley paced the team with a time of 17:28.98, finishing 7th overall. Not far behind,
Crystal Coke ran a strong race to secure 10th place with a time of 17:47.96, giving Morgan State two scorers inside the top tier.
The remainder of the squad added depth and consistency across the board:
● 14th –
Hemetii Apet (18:40)
● 16th – Sydney Moore (19:15)
● 21st –
Kayla More (19:52)
● 22nd –
Aiana Showell (21:12)
● 24th –
Kayla Gordon (21:43)
When the final scores were tallied, Morgan State finished fourth overall out of the four competing teams. While the Lady Bears came up short in the standings, the season opener served as an important benchmark and revealed areas of strength the team can build on as the year unfolds.
With Headley and Coke leading the way, the Lady Bears now shift their focus to their next test at the Delaware State Invitational on September 12 in Smyrna, Del. The meet will provide another opportunity for Morgan State to sharpen its competitive edge and continue climbing the standings.
"Today's meet gave us a clear understanding of where we stand as a team in training," said Morgan State head coach
Neville Hodge. "We had a strong team effort, and I believe we will only improve from this point. Our goal moving forward is to be more aggressive upfront and to finish stronger at the end."
